Job Summary:
This role involves managing the inventory accounting system, reconciling inventory accounts, conducting regular audits, and ensuring compliance with financial regulations.
Key Responsibilities:
Accounting, Reporting, Analysis
- Daily accounting entries are correct, complete, timely and authorized (stock, production, losses/variances/shrink). Both execution as well as review of OPS entries.
- Weekly reporting and analysis of inventory management information and production information (stock levels, value/Mt, position in days, DIO, extraction, obsoleteness, slow moving, stock variances, wheat cost per Mt, extraction, shrink)
- Root cause analysis of all inventories related identified issues and follow up on action plans and timing
- Reconcile BI and NAV.
- Reconcile GO and NAV.
- Manufacturing and RM cost analysis and reconciliation.
- Prepare any other required reports (internal or external) related to the areas of responsibilities.
Controls and Compliance
- Perform allocated monthly balance sheet reconciliations are adequately prepared, reviewed and concluded on WD+5.
- Review allocated balance sheet reconciliation for selected accounts.
- Setup a mass balance control.
- Stock take management (plan, lead, conclude, report)
- Grind out certification
- Verification of NAV information on inventory and production (q, p, provisions, BOM etc)
- Compliance of inventory related (accounting policies) and translation to local policies.
- Communicate timely on non- compliance with standards for inventory and production
Audits, reviews, assessments
- Support the year end audit and ensure that auditors are provided with the required information and documentation on time.
- Lead and ensure accurate and timely completion of other internal, external and governmental audits.
- Responsible for timely and effective remediation of all audit findings occurring in the area of responsibility
